About

About the CZ75-Auto | Chalice

The CZ75-Auto | Chalice is a Restricted-grade skin in Counter-Strike 2, featuring the Chalice finish on the CZ75-Auto — see All CZ75-Auto skins.

Rarity

The CZ75-Auto | Chalice is a Restricted-grade skin.

Float and wear

The float value of the CZ75-Auto | Chalice runs from 0.00 to 0.10. Not every wear exists for it, which is why some exteriors are scarcer and priced apart. Within a wear, a lower float looks cleaner in game and usually costs more.

Versions

A Souvenir version drops from CS2 Major matches, with gold stickers for the event, the teams and the MVP; it is rarer than the standard skin.

Factory New (FN) CZ75-Auto | Chalice skins have float values between 0.00-0.07, showing minimal to no visible wear. Minimal Wear (MW) floats range from 0.07-0.15, with slight scratches or fading. This skin has a restricted float range (0.00-0.10), meaning Battle-Scarred versions don't exist. The price gap between FN and MW varies by finish — some designs like the Chalice pattern hide wear better than others, making MW versions a strong value alternative.

Float values in CS2 determine a skin's wear level on a scale from 0.00 (perfect) to 1.00 (maximum wear). With a float range of 0.00 to 0.10, this skin has specific wear availability that affects pricing. Lower float values within any condition category (e.g., 0.01 vs 0.06 in Factory New) result in cleaner appearances and typically command higher prices. For high-value trades, always verify the exact float value using inspection tools.

Souvenir skins are exclusive drops from CS2 Major tournament matches. They feature gold stickers commemorating the specific match, teams, and MVP player. Souvenir CZ75-Auto | Chalice cannot be obtained through regular case openings, making them significantly rarer than standard versions. The value depends heavily on which tournament, match, and player signatures are featured. High-profile player autographs (like s1mple or ZywOo) can multiply the skin's value several times over.

Yes, all weapon skins including the CZ75-Auto | Chalice are purely cosmetic and can be used in all CS2 game modes including competitive matchmaking, Premier, and professional tournaments. Skins provide no gameplay advantages or disadvantages - they only change the weapon's visual appearance. Many professional players use skins during official matches, and you'll often see high-value items like this featured in tournament broadcasts.

The CZ75-Auto | Chalice is part of The Cobblestone Collection. Souvenir versions drop exclusively during CS2 Major tournament matches. All skins from the same collection share a rarity hierarchy, which affects trade-up contract possibilities and overall value.

The in-game description reads: "A fully automatic variant of the CZ75, the CZ75-Auto is the ideal short-term choice for turning the tables and gaining your opponents weapon. But with very little ammo in the magazine, strong trigger discipline is required. A bird of prey carrying a snake has been custom painted on this CZ75. A snake eater, minus the catchy theme song" The Chalice finish on the CZ75-Auto is a distinctive design that has made this skin a recognizable part of CS2's visual identity.
